How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 94188?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 94188 Studio Apartments | $3,907 | $936 | $9,243 |
| 94188 1 Bedroom Apartments | $5,014 | $898 | $12,823 |
| 94188 2 Bedroom Apartments | $7,050 | $1,022 | $20,620 |
| 94188 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,960 | $1,120 | $25,392 |
| 94188 4 Bedroom Apartments | $7,721 | $1,429 | $14,236 |
| 94188 5 Bedroom Apartments | $8,263 | $7,395 | $10,000+ |
